Ticket: Flaky DNS resolution in Pinecone ingest workers

Severity: P2. Roughly 1 in 40 requests from ingest workers fails name resolution for the metrics host, then succeeds on retry.

Repro:
1. Deploy worker to the Dunmore pool.
2. Run the soak script for 10 minutes.
3. Observe intermittent resolution errors in logs.

Soak script auth uses the token below.

session JWT of yawep-yawep = eyJhbGciOiJIUzI1NiIsInR5cCI6IkpXVCJ9.eyJzdWIiOiI3pWF3_In0.aXYsHiog

## Currency Conversion Rounding

When reviewing changes to the Lendrix conversion module, pay close attention to rounding. All amounts must be converted using banker's rounding at four decimal places, then truncated to the target currency's minor unit. Never round intermediate sums; accumulate in fixed-point and round once at display time. The regression suite in `fxcheck` validates this against the Quorvane rates service. To run it locally you will need the key below.

service key, tadup-tahog: zpat7_wB1tnEL

**Vendor note: Inkmill markdown pipeline**

Rendering for Parchway docs is outsourced to Inkmill under an annual contract, renewing each March. They handle sanitization and PDF export; we own the upload queue. SLA: 4-hour response on rendering failures. Escalate only after two failed retries. Their support desk is reachable at the address below.

billing contact of hahaf-baguf = zorael.tammir.jorius@sivrelhq.internal

## Runbook: Splitgate Assigner

Splitgate assigns A/B buckets at request time. Assignments are sticky per visitor hash; never re-randomize live experiments or metrics are garbage. If assignment latency alarms fire, check the hash-ring health first, then the experiment registry sync job. Rollbacks: revert the registry snapshot, not the service. Before touching anything, confirm the service is running with the expected configuration values, reproduced here.

deployment values, yadup-kadug:
[sorys]
port = 5672
team = noveth
host = sorys.orvexcorp.example
region = south-4
access_code = ac_deddc1
timeout_ms = 1500